Just quoted a client for a lennox OEM part 48K98 blower board for a G20 to have him come back at me saying that part is available on multiple online sites in lennox packaging for 1/2 to 2/3rds less than what the local lennox quoted to me.
I called lennox head office and they confirmed their quote price but couldn't explain why their own brand part was 2 - 3 times the cost over what the online sites were selling????

Anyone run into this?? Is some major lennox supplier dumping stock??

Lennox has different tier pricing for their dealers depending on how much stuff you buy and I am sure most wholesalers do as well. Larger Lennox dealers get better pricing than smaller ones and GM etc do the same with cars. Probably the customer is lying or your Lennox dealer is not being good to you. C'est la Vie. Years ago, when I was a GM at a company, that was not a Lennox dealer. We would often get our Lennox parts from one of the Lennox dealers when we needed the part fast. We had an agreement with them, they only charged us 10% mark up, so it kept us competitive with them and other Lennox dealers.

You might be able to make an arrangement/agreement with one of the Lennox dealers in your area.
